A Graduate Certificate in Biomaterials specializing in biodegradable materials equips students with the advanced knowledge and skills necessary to design, develop, and evaluate innovative biocompatible and biodegradable materials for various biomedical applications. This intensive program focuses on the latest advancements in polymer chemistry, biomaterial processing, and biodegradation mechanisms.
Learning outcomes include a comprehensive understanding of biomaterial selection criteria, degradation kinetics, and in-vivo biocompatibility testing. Students gain hands-on experience through laboratory work, project-based learning, and potentially, collaborative research opportunities with industry partners. The program fosters critical thinking and problem-solving skills crucial for translating scientific discoveries into impactful biomaterial technologies.
The typical duration of a Graduate Certificate in Biomaterials is 12 to 18 months, depending on the program structure and course load. Many programs offer flexible learning options, such as online or part-time study, to accommodate working professionals.
This certificate holds significant industry relevance, catering to the growing demand for sustainable and environmentally friendly biomaterials within the medical device, pharmaceutical, and tissue engineering sectors. Graduates are well-prepared for careers in research and development, quality control, regulatory affairs, and technical sales, contributing to the advancement of biodegradable implants, drug delivery systems, and regenerative medicine.
The program integrates knowledge of polymer science, biocompatibility, biodegradation, and tissue engineering principles. Students explore the application of biodegradable polymers such as polylactic acid (PLA) and polyglycolic acid (PGA) in various biomedical devices and systems. This focus on sustainable biomaterials positions graduates at the forefront of a rapidly evolving field.
